@moduledoc """
Render inline SVG.
## Initialization
```ex
def SVGHelper do
use InlineSVG, root: "assets/static/svg", default_collection: "generic"
end
```
This will generate functions for each SVG file, effectively caching them at
compile time.
## Usage
### render SVG from default collection
```ex
svg("home")
```
It will load the SVG file from `assets/static/svg/generic/home.svg`:
```html
<svg>...</svg>
```
### render SVG from other collections
You can break up SVG files into collections, and use the second argument of
`svg/2` to specify the name of collection:
```ex
svg("user", "fontawesome")
```
It will load the SVG file from `assets/static/svg/fontawesome/user.svg`:
```html
<svg>...</svg>
```
### render SVG with custom HTML attributes
You can also pass optional HTML attributes into the function to set those
attributes on the SVG:
```ex
svg("home", class: "logo", id: "bounce-animation")
svg("home", "fontawesome", class: "logo", id: "bounce-animation")
```
It will output:
```html
<svg class="logo" id="bounce-animation">...</svg>
<svg class="logo" id="bounce-animation">...</svg>
```
## Options
There are several configuration options for meeting your needs.
### `:root`
Specify the directory from which to load SVG files.
You must specify it by your own.
### `:default_collection`
Specify the default collection to use.
The deafult value is `generic`.
## Use in Phoenix
An example:
```ex
def DemoWeb.SVGHelper do
use InlineSVG,
root: "assets/static/svg",
default_collection: "generic",
function_prefix: "_"
def svg(arg1) do
Phoenix.HTML.raw(_svg(arg1))
end
def svg(arg1, arg2) do
Phoenix.HTML.raw(_svg(arg1, arg2))
end
def svg(arg1, arg2, arg3) do
Phoenix.HTML.raw(_svg(arg1, arg2, arg3))
end
end
```
